1. First Impressions Start with You
When you dress with intention, you signal to yourself that you matter.
Before anyone else sees your outfit, you see it — and that moment sets the tone for your day.
Even a soft cotton tunic or a coordinated set can create a shift in energy.
2. Fashion Is a Mood Enhancer
Colors, textures, and silhouettes affect how you feel.
Wearing something you love — a pastel kurta, a flowy gown, a well-fitted tunic — can uplift your mood and reduce stress.
Pastel tones like blush, lavender, or mint are proven to create a calming effect.
3. Fabric That Feels Good = Instant Comfort
When your clothes feel soft, breathable, and made for you, your mind relaxes.
At Ivory, we work with fabrics like cotton-silk blends and modal satins for this very reason — they flow with your body, not against it.

4. The Mirror Effect: What You See Shapes How You Feel
Looking polished — even in something simple — makes you walk taller.
When you catch a glimpse of yourself in the mirror and like what you see, it builds confidence from within.
Tip: Keep a few “happy outfits” that always make you feel your best.
5. Rituals of Dressing = Acts of Self-Care
Laying out your clothes, steaming a fabric, adding a delicate accessory — these are slow, mindful rituals that anchor you.
They’re not just about style — they’re about honoring your time, body, and self-worth.

6. Dressing for Yourself vs. Others
The true confidence boost comes when you dress for you.
It’s not about trends or rules — it’s about choosing clothes that align with how you want to feel and show up.
Start asking yourself: How do I want to feel today? Then dress for that.
